Read the Motion Before Writing the Next Prompt
Before using a Kling video extender, watch the final seconds several times.
Ignore the story for a moment and look only at motion.

Where Is the Subject Traveling?
Is the subject moving toward the camera, away from it, across the frame, upward, downward, or in a circular path?
What Is the Current Speed?
Is the movement accelerating, slowing down, or staying steady?
What Is the Camera Doing?
Is it tracking alongside the subject, orbiting, zooming, pushing forward, pulling back, panning, or remaining fixed?
What Action Has Already Started?
A character might already be reaching for something, turning their head, jumping, opening a door, or beginning to sit.
The next prompt should acknowledge that state.
This simple analysis makes Kling video extender prompts more connected to the physical logic of the original footage.
Use Subject + Movement as the Core Prompt
For motion-focused continuation, complicated descriptions are not always necessary.
A useful Kling video extender prompt can begin with two elements:
Subject + next movement

Base: subject + next movement“The skateboarder lands the jump and continues forward.”
Add camera direction“The skateboarder lands the jump and continues forward while the camera tracks beside him at the same speed.”
Add one continuity instruction“The skateboarder lands the jump and continues forward while the camera tracks beside him at the same speed, preserving the sunset lighting and concrete skatepark.”
The resulting prompt is easy to understand because every phrase contributes to movement or continuity.
Extend Walking and Running Sequences
Human locomotion is a natural use case for a Kling video extender.
Suppose a Kling clip shows a character walking through a crowded night market. The original video ends while the person is still moving.

Instead of asking for a new scene, continue the trajectory:
Walking example“The woman keeps walking through the market, passes a food stall on her right, and turns toward a narrow alley while the tracking camera remains behind her.”
The prompt describes where the person goes and how the camera follows.
For running scenes, it can also help to specify changes in pace:
Running example“The runner accelerates toward the stairs, climbs them quickly, and reaches the rooftop as the camera follows from a low angle.”
Clear physical progression gives the Kling video extender a sequence rather than a vague request.
Continue Dance and Performance Videos
Dance clips contain coordinated body movement, timing, and rhythm.
A Kling video extender can be used to continue a performance when the existing motion already looks good.
Instead of describing a whole new choreography, identify the next move.
Dance example“The dancer completes the spin, steps backward twice, raises both arms, and transitions into a slower movement while the camera remains centered.”
The prompt establishes a physical chain.
For performance footage, avoid adding several unrelated camera changes unless that is intentionally part of the style. A stable camera can sometimes make body continuity easier to evaluate.
Extend Vehicles Without Breaking Direction
Cars, motorcycles, trains, boats, aircraft, and other vehicles create strong directional cues.
If a vehicle is traveling forward at high speed, the continuation should respect that momentum.

A Kling video extender prompt could say:
Vehicle example“The motorcycle continues accelerating through the tunnel, passes beneath three overhead lights, and exits into the rain while the camera follows closely behind.”
This works because the continuation has a clear path.
Vehicle extensions can also introduce environmental changes gradually: entering a tunnel, rounding a curve, reaching a bridge, passing traffic, leaving a city, or moving from daylight toward sunset.
The important point is that the next event grows out of the current trajectory.
Keep Camera Motion on the Same Path
The camera itself may be the most important moving object in a Kling video.
A Kling video extender can help continue:
- Forward tracking shots
- Side tracking shots
- Slow push-ins
- Pullbacks
- Orbits
- Crane-like rises
- Low-angle follows
- Pans and aerial movement

If the original camera is orbiting clockwise around a product, asking for an immediate reverse orbit may feel abrupt.
Instead:
Camera example“The camera continues the clockwise orbit, gradually moving closer until the front logo fills more of the frame.”
That gives the Kling video extender both direction and destination.
Camera instructions are particularly useful for product videos, architecture, vehicles, fashion, and cinematic establishing shots.
Use Kling Video Extension for Product Motion
Product videos often contain controlled movement rather than narrative action.
A shoe may rotate above a platform. A bottle may slide into light. A watch may move from shadow into a close detail. A device may open or transform.

A Kling video extender can develop these motions into additional angles.
Rotation example“The headphones continue rotating slowly while the camera lowers toward product level and the reflective surface remains unchanged.”
Transform example“The smartphone finishes unfolding, the screen lights up, and the camera moves toward the display.”
These prompts focus on product geometry and movement rather than adding unnecessary story elements.
Create Longer Action Sequences in Stages
A complicated action sequence is often easier to build as several connected movements.
A Kling video extender can turn one successful action into the starting point for the next.
Imagine an adventure sequence:

Next movement
A character runs through a forest.
Next movement
The character reaches a fallen tree and jumps over it.
Next movement
They land and slide down a slope.
Next movement
The camera follows as they reach a river.
Each stage has a physical relationship with the previous one.
This is different from trying to generate a long prompt containing an entire chase, explosion, jump, dialogue scene, location change, and final reveal at once.
Incremental continuation gives each movement more attention.
Control Change to Reduce Visual Drift
Every new action creates opportunities for visual details to change.
A practical Kling video extender strategy is to decide what is allowed to change and what should remain stable.
Change
- The character walks from the street into a building.
- The vehicle rounds a corner and slows.
Keep
- Character clothing, hairstyle, time of day, camera perspective, and general visual treatment.
- Vehicle appearance, road conditions, lighting, camera position, and weather.
Prompts become clearer when they separate progression from continuity.
If the extension begins drifting, reduce the number of new variables.
Avoid Motion Contradictions
A continuation can feel unnatural even when individual frames look good.
This often happens because the new motion contradicts the original movement.
Consider a camera quickly tracking alongside a car. If the next segment suddenly becomes a perfectly stationary front view without a transition, the viewer experiences a visual break.
The same problem occurs when a person is turning left but suddenly appears facing right, or when an object changes speed without a physical reason.
Before using a Kling video extender, identify the current motion vector and decide whether you want to maintain it, slow it, redirect it, or stop it.
If the direction needs to change, describe the transition.
Direction change“The runner slows, looks back, then turns and runs toward the opposite side of the street” is clearer than simply requesting “the runner runs the other way.”
Use the Environment to Carry Motion Forward
The main subject does not always need to perform the new action.
A Kling video extender can continue movement through the environment.
- Wind can become stronger.
- Rain can intensify.
- Crowds can move around a stationary character.
- Lights can turn on throughout a building.
- Fog can reveal a structure.
- Water can rise or flow through the frame.
This is useful when the subject should remain stable while the scene develops.
Environmental motion can also create more cinematic pacing by allowing the viewer to observe the world before another major action begins.
Create Better Endings for Kling AI Videos
Sometimes a clip does not need a longer middle. It simply needs an ending.
A Kling video extender can create a final action that gives the shot closure.
- A person can stop at a destination.
- A vehicle can disappear into the distance.
- A product can settle into a final hero composition.
- A camera can pull back and reveal the complete environment.
- A performer can finish a movement and hold the final pose.
Thinking specifically about closure helps avoid extensions that keep adding action without giving the video a natural endpoint.
Evaluate a Kling Extension Frame by Frame
When reviewing a Kling video extender result, do more than ask whether it looks visually impressive.

Check:
- Does the subject remain recognizable?
- Does the body movement follow the previous pose?
- Does speed change naturally?
- Does the camera continue from the expected position?
- Do background objects remain spatially believable?
- Does lighting stay consistent?
- Does the new action have a clear endpoint?
These questions help identify whether a problem comes from appearance, motion, camera behavior, or scene structure.
You can then adjust the next continuation prompt more precisely.

Kling Video Extender for Social Video
Short-form content benefits from movement that immediately communicates an idea.
A Kling video extender can turn one dynamic generation into additional material for TikTok, Reels, Shorts, product promos, visual hooks, and branded edits.
Instead of duplicating a five-second action, creators can continue it into a second beat.
For example, a fashion clip might begin with a model turning toward the camera. The continuation could follow the model walking past the lens and transition attention toward the environment.
A product clip could begin with an object entering the frame and end with an extended detail reveal.
The extra duration now contains progression instead of repetition.
